Exclusive Codemasters Tournaments At i15 LAN Party

by Thomas on Feb. 11, 2003 @ 2:16 a.m. PST

Multiplay, the UK's leading "LAN Party" organisers today announced the sponsorship of their upcoming i15 event by the game publisher Codemasters. This sponsorship will bring prize-winning tournaments to the event for two of the latest games from Codemasters, the first-person shooter Project IGI2 and long awaited sequel to Toca Touring Cars 2, Toca Race Driver. A prize fund of £1,500 is up for grabs in the IGI2 tournament, which will be played on the retail version of the game due for release on the 21st February. The tournament will see up to 48 clans (teams) battling it out for a share in the prize money. To make things interesting, the i15 tournament play will include a completely new map, pre-released exclusively to i15 attendees.

The Toca Race Driver tournament will be played on the multiplayer demo of the game, soon to be released on the Internet. It will provide the opportunity for gamers who are dab hand behind a racing wheel the chance to win a Thunderdome challenge day, in which they'll get to drive 12 real-life racing cars round a 200mph oval circuit, courtesy of www.jhrockinghamexperience.co.uk. The competition is set to be fierce!

i15 is the latest in the highly successful "i-series" of events from Multiplay, and will see over 1000 gamers from all over the UK and beyond get together for a weekend of gaming on a superfast Local Area Network. Taking place over 14-16 March at Newbury Racecourse, Newbury, UK, the event runs non-stop, giving the gamers over 57 hours of multiplayer gaming action!

Tournament entrants will get the chance to hone their skills and practise for the IGI2 tournament on several servers Multiplay will be hosting on its recently launched online gaming service (http://gaming.multiplay.co.uk)

Craig Fletcher, Managing Director of Multiplay said: "We're really excited to have Codemasters on board for our i15 event. It's great to see game publishers taking the multiplayer communities and growing tournament scene seriously. Professional gaming is already a reality in the USA, and it is support like this we need to bring it to the UK."

"We've already received a huge interest in the i15 event, and it's set to be our largest yet! With massive demand on places we're expecting well over 1000 players at the event, which would break all our existing records and make i15 the first UK LAN party to exceed this milestone. It's all very exciting stuff!"

Project IGI2 is a groundbreaking first-person shooter combining a tense, stealthy single player campaign with a plethora of engaging multiplayer game options. Anticipation for the game among the UK gaming community is huge, with Codemasters anticipating only 15,000 gamers to join the closed beta, when in fact over 100,000 were falling over themselves to register!

Nicky Veal, European Marketing Manager at Codemasters said: "Codemasters are very pleased to support the i15 event as we recognise the value and importance of the active IGI2 online community and are keen to be involved in its development and growth."
